Process crash via unsafe array allocation sinking
Published Nov 4, 2025 · Updated Nov 4, 2025
WebKit flaws in Apple operating systems and Safari before 26.1 allow remote attackers to crash a web-content process with crafted content. WebKit's array allocation sinking optimization performs unsafe transformations on crafted JavaScript arrays; Apple has not disclosed the individual faulting operations. A victim must process attacker-controlled web content, and the documented consequence is a process crash rather than device shutdown or code execution.
